Beef / Mutton Stew


Ingredients

  • 1 kilogram of beef or mutton ,medium sized cubes
  • 500 grams of onions (sliced)
  • 500 grams yougurt,whisked
  • 1 tsp. of garlic paste
  • 1 tsp. of ginger paste
  • 5-6 Whole black peppers
  • 4-6 cloves
  • 2 Big Black cardamoms
  • 1 stick of cinnamon
  • 1/2 tbsp. cumin seeds
  • 3 tbsp. of coriander ,crushed
  • 1 1/2 tbsp red chillies ,crushed
  • 1 tbsp salt ( or to taste)
  • 1/2 cup oil
  • 2-3 Green Chillies (chopped - for garnish)
  • A few fresh coriander leaves (for garnish)



Procedure
Put oil in a heavy pot, add the onions and saute until golden brown-transparent.
Add the meat to the onions, and constantly stir until the water dries up.
Mix all of the ingredients above in yougurt and add to meat. (Except for the Fresh Coriander Leaves and Green Chillies).
Mix and saute for a few mintes.
Now add enough water so the meat can tenderize.
Cover pot. And let the meat cook on low heat.
When the meat is well tender and cooked,cook on high heat,stiiring continuosly until oil separates.
Add fresh coriander leaves, and chopped green chillies.
Mix and remove from heat.
Serve hot with naan or chapati.
